Live In Pictures: Camden Rocks All-Dayer at The Black Heart ft. Branwell Black, Liars Teeth, Tar Babies, Two Pound Tea, Dirty Mitts, Electric Black + Solar Strides

After a year and a half in which North London’s music venues fell silent, the venerable folk at Camden Rocks have been making up for lost time with a relentless programme of heavy rock all-dayers in their home borough’s finest small music spaces. This week they were back at The Black Heart, with a line-up that included theatrical electro-rockers Branwell Black, atomspheric alt-rock four-piece Liars Teeth, the garage-psych sounds of Tar Babies, Two Pound Tea‘s high energy rock and roll, multi-national blues-rock quartet Dirty Mitts, the powerful riffs of Electric Black and indie rockers Solar Strides. Joyzine’s Rupert Hitchcox was down the front to capture the night’s events on camera.
